Output 2676e3855ee05db4d3607e69ca2b03a03436eb27f2138bd136aa9209ac37d71a:1

value
1870474900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2db4a3ac3d829e6b664fbad6a6fca4d2d6687366 OP_EQUALVERIFY OP_CHECKSIG
address
15Afog76yK3KkoY7U7c69Bg1bn5L5E6t6o
transaction
2676e3855ee05db4d3607e69ca2b03a03436eb27f2138bd136aa9209ac37d71a
spent
true